Résumé

In a small African town divided by tribal tradition and economic power, a gifted teenage boy from a struggling home falls in love with the last girl he should ever want - Magam, the intelligent and untouchable daughter of his family's wealthy landlords. What begins as tutoring sessions quietly evolves into a love neither of them dares name aloud. Their bond deepens through stolen letters, secret meetings, and a sacred blood pact sworn beneath moonlight, meant to bind them forever.
But when jealousy, betrayal, and cultural politics converge, their world collapses. Siblings become strangers. Love becomes a liability. And silence becomes survival. Magam is forced into marriage. He disappears into exile. And for fifteen years, their love becomes a ghost story only the walls remember. Then, a letter arrives - unmarked but unmistakable - and with it, a chance to finish the story they were never allowed to write.
Told with haunting lyricism and cinematic intimacy, Blood Pact is the first installment in The Satanic Verses of Love series-a sweeping, emotionally rich novel about forbidden love, intergenerational trauma, and the endurance of memory. It is a tribute to every soul who ever wrote a poem in the dark and waited for the light to find it.
